German Business Sentiment Picks Up
German business sentiment showed a tentative improvement in February, with the Ifo business climate index rising to 88.6, surpassing the forecasted 88.4 and reaching its highest level since August. This uptick suggests the German economy may be starting to turn a corner. Both current business conditions and future expectations improved, with the respective indices increasing. This positive development is supported by recent data showing strong order intake in the manufacturing sector and accelerated business activity growth in the composite PMI. While economists express cautious optimism, potential downside risks include tariff uncertainty, a stronger euro, and recent winter weather. The overall sentiment indicates a potential cyclical upswing for Europe's largest economy.
